The Keota Eagle softball team continued a streak this season; and it’s not a streak you want to have.

For the third straight year, the Eagles did not win a single game.  The program’s last win dates back to July 7, 2015 when they beat winless Harmony 11-1 in five innings.  Since then, they have been the victim of the mercy rule several times; including 15 of their 17 losses this season coming in five innings or less.

Offensively, the Eagles’ best batting average was .250, which came in the form of eighth-grader Taylor Kindred.  No player had any more than three RBI throughout the year, as they had as many RBI as a team as they did losses this season.  As a whole, Eagle pitchers finished the year with a combined 19.91 ERA; the second-highest in the state.

On the bright side, every player on the roster will be eligible to return next season.  Having a core with a year under their belts together could be a start at snapping that streak, and eventually getting back to winning fashion.
